“Good spot for an overnight stop”

Reviewed 10/18/2020

Nightly rate: $16
Days stayed: 1
Site Number: ?
RV Length: 20' (Travel Trailer)
Overall Rating

We stopped here for an overnight on the way to Missouri. The location is convenient to the highway. The campground is mostly open and doesn't offer a lot of privacy and there isn't a lot of space between sites. Many of the spots are pull through and ours had water and electric hookup. We stayed on a Wednesday night in late September and there were plenty of spots open. The dump station was of good quality. We had solid Verizon coverage and 12 TV channels. Our spot was fairly level. This campground is a great spot for an overnight stop, though I'm not sure I'd want to stay much more than that. If you need a bit to eat while staying I'd recommend the Dairy Mart and getting the Corn Nuggets.

“Nice county park”

Reviewed 6/6/2020

Nightly rate: $16
Days stayed: 1
Site Number: 1
Overall Rating

Stopped for the night while heading south. A few open spots on a June Friday night At 915 pm. Quiet and nice trails and conservation center. Clean. Showers closed due to Covid.
Dog friendly.
Not as spacious as a state park,,but this is in the middle of Iowa farm country.
